Output 3aca8916457b5bb77e88bfdc60befcd2a225bf49798e8aaa42cb507285d2e60e:2

value
154234860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ac05ec7de45e593cf278c148cf4ba121911595f OP_EQUAL
address
MK6D7xAU8Ryb3agqVeFABizSoBohYLk8S1
transaction
3aca8916457b5bb77e88bfdc60befcd2a225bf49798e8aaa42cb507285d2e60e
spent
true